    Vic Trotters Derby heats on Sunday at Maryborough with the Final the following Sunday
    That will amount to 4 runs in 4 weeks for Pink Galahs - no small program for a 3yo filly on a modified program because of some concern/injury
    Only 2 heats so the first 5 are guaranteed a start in the final

    It was blowing a gale down the home straight but nevertheless you would have to say that Elite Stride was disappointing in his heat.
    It was only his second loss in 11 starts but maybe it was the 2690m
    Pink Galahs had a cushy run to beat Powderkeg who returned to form

    Gimondi from NSW was too strong in the other heat

    I am guessing that Aldebaran Ursula's 1.55.7 had to be a record for a 2yo/early 3yo trotter especially a filly

    http://www.harness.org.au/racing/fie...20#BNC04122008
    Australasian Record for a 2yo, regardless of gender.

    Aldebaran Ursula broke her own record previously established at Menangle.

    Utopia's mile rate of 1:58.6 winning the Gavin Lang is an Australasian Record for 2yo trotting colts.
